城市街区道路交通布局与降雨径流污染关系研究——以杭州市为例 被引量:2

Research on the Relationship Between Urban Road Traffic Layout and Runoff Pollution: A Case Study in Hangzhou
下载PDF
导出
摘要 城市道路降雨径流污染日益加重,其中一个重要的原因在于城市街区土地利用过程中道路交通布局结构的不合理。文章基于杭州市地形图和谷歌地图,解译得出杭州4个典型街区的道路交通布局结构指数,并通过实验的方法同步得到4个街区的水质指数;运用SPSS和Matlab软件,分析降雨径流污染及其与街区道路交通布局结构的相关性。结论为:交通性路网是造成城市道路径流污染的主要原因;非交通性路网密度的增加及公共交通环境的改善能够引导优化居民出行方式,有效抑制个体机动化出行,避免道路雨水径流水质的持续恶化。最后,提出面向径流水质优化的城市街区道路交通布局结构建议。 Urban road runoff pollution has been a rising problem, for which the unreasonable road traffic layout structure in the process of urban land-use has been one of the most important reasons. This paper interpreted the road traffic layout structure index of 4 typical blocks in Hangzhou based on the topographic map and Google Earth images, and measured the water quality index of the 4 blocks. It analyzed the relationship between traffic layout structure of urban road and runoff pollution using SPSS statistical analysis software and Matlab, so as to reveal the mechanism on the impacts of road traffic layout structure to rainfall runoff water quality and finally proposed some strategies and recommendations to optimize urban road traffic layout structure.
